Teeth whitening
Probably the most common and recognizable of all the aesthetic procedures is dental teeth whitening. One of the reasons this is so popular is how easy it is for teeth to become stained and discolored.
While there are many at-home whitening kits available, they are not nearly as effective as the whitening performed by your dentist. For this reason, many patients prefer whitening to be done in the dental office. This is because your dentist will have access to much more powerful ingredients and tools. There are options such as laser whitening and fluoride bleaching that can penetrate the outer layer of the teeth to get them many shades whiter.
Dental veneers
One of the cosmetic procedures that not only makes your smile look better but protects it from further damage is having dental veneers placed on your teeth. A dental veneer is essentially a protective coating that is placed over the front of your teeth.
The coating helps restore the look of stained and discolored teeth to a more natural white smile. The coating then helps protect from staining and damage by acting as a barrier for your natural teeth. If you're looking for a way to make your natural teeth look great and last longer, this is a great option.
Dental bonding
Bonding is another way to restore our smile, but this procedure aims to repair and reshape teeth that have suffered damage instead of just teeth that are discolored or stained. The way dental bonding works is that your dentist uses a special composite material shaded to be as close as possible to natural tooth color.
The composite material is used to reshape damaged, cracked, or chipped teeth to restore them to their natural look. Even moderately damaged teeth can be made to look like new natural teeth, thanks to dental bonding. Once the material hardens, the best part is that it's as durable as natural teeth, and you'll be eating and smiling again like normal.
Cosmetic braces
While traditional braces are typically an orthodontic procedure, invisible braces and aligners are cosmetic procedures with most of the same benefits as traditional braces without all the metal brackets and wires. Cosmetic braces can restore mild to moderate alignment issues while being much more comfortable, faster, and better looking than traditional braces.
